Algorithmes génétiques

Les algorithmes génétiques sont une famille d’algorithmes d’optimisation inspirés par le processus d’évolution naturelle. Qu’est-ce que les algorithmes génétiques ? Ce sont des méthodes de recherche qui imitent la sélection naturelle pour trouver la meilleure solution à un problème.

Comment fonctionnent les algorithmes génétiques ?

Imaginez un éleveur de chiens cherchant à obtenir la race parfaite pour la course. Il sélectionne les chiens les plus rapides, les fait se reproduire, et espère que leurs chiots seront encore plus performants. Les algorithmes génétiques fonctionnent de manière similaire. Ils partent d’une population de solutions potentielles (les « individus »), évaluent leur performance (« fitness »), sélectionnent les meilleurs, les « croisent » pour créer de nouvelles solutions, et introduisent des mutations aléatoires pour explorer de nouvelles possibilités. Ce cycle se répète jusqu’à ce qu’une solution satisfaisante soit trouvée.

Pourquoi les algorithmes génétiques sont-ils importants ?

En IA et en prompt engineering, les algorithmes génétiques peuvent être utilisés pour optimiser la conception de modèles, la sélection de paramètres ou la génération de prompts. Ils permettent d’explorer un large espace de solutions sans avoir à les tester toutes individuellement. Par exemple, ils peuvent être utilisés pour trouver les meilleurs hyperparamètres d’un réseau de neurones ou pour générer automatiquement des prompts performants pour la génération de texte.

Termes associés

Laisser un commentaire

Retour en haut